Wearing helmets won’t save us anymore. I am referring to the accident that took place in Mapuca where the road roller came tumbling down and killed a poor woman. The brakes failed. Are the police, RTO really very serious ? Was this roller inspected this year and did the RTO check the hand brakes and the other brakes ? If so how did the brakes fail? Normally when a truck, bus, and other heavy machineries are serviced every six months there cannot be any failure. Some years back a bus rammed into a shop at that same very sport killing a lady. Some years back the wheels of a truck came rolling down from the municipality building till Maruti Temple knocking one person’s brains out from his skull. Years back a truck came down the slope of Datta wadi and rammed into a shop behind Bank of India. So it is not helmet that can save our lives but honest RTO officers, honest policemen.
